Evan Burton Posted February 25, 2015 Share Posted February 25, 2015 I tend to disagree. There are conflicting reports about the projected casualties of a Japanese invasion but we do know a lot of allied personnel thought it saved many lives. We also know that the Japanese people were prepared for a bloody guerrilla war in case of invasion. I don't think there can ever be a definitive answer, only opinions. Michael Griffith Posted July 25, 2022 Share Posted July 25, 2022 Yes, I believe that Hiroshima was a war crime. I'm sure many here know that by June 1945 Japan was beaten and prostrate. Mainland Japan was virtually defenseless against air attacks. Bombing runs over the Japanese home islands were losing only 0.003 of our bombers in air raids on Japan—in other words, only 3 out of every 1,000 bombers were being shot down. Every major Japanese port had been mined. The Japanese people were on the verge of starvation. All this being said, if we had nuked a genuine military target, I would not object nearly as much.
